REMINDER:
Proper Etiquette in Responding to Listserv Postings

Job, volunteer, and internship postings that are sent out on the listserv are professional and should be responded to professionally. It is unacceptable to send the contact person an e-mail that just simply says: “I’m interested” or to use text message lingo in a response.

All e-mails or letters should have a greeting and a closing in addition to proper punctuation and grammar. 

For Example:
Dear Ms. Smith:
My name is Sally Jones, and I am interested in the posting that was sent out on the Hunter College listserv. I am an undergraduate student at Hunter College, pursuing dental school and an opportunity to work in your office would be a great learning experience.

Attached are my resume and cover letter.

Thank you for your time.
Sally Jones
